What is the suitable season for transplanting trumpet creeper?

Trumpet creeper is a very common plant nowadays, but if you use seedlings to inoculate directly in pots, the growth rate is very slow, so it is best to plant it in the ground for three or four years. Trumpet creeper can be transplanted when the environment begins to warm up, and it can be transplanted after March and before September.

Points to note when transplanting trumpet creeper

1. Transplanting and pruning

It is best to transplant Trumpet Creeper in early spring every year. When transplanting, pay attention to proper pruning of the plant, keep the main trunk about 30-40 cm, and properly prune the residual roots, old roots, and fine roots at the root to provide guarantee for healthy growth after transplanting.

2. Build the bracket

Trumpet creeper is a climbing plant. When the plant grows to a certain height, it needs support to assist the main trunk in climbing. Therefore, when transplanting, pay attention to building a support around the new potting soil to prevent the plant from falling over when it grows too high.

Trumpet creeper transplanting management

After the trumpet creeper is transplanted, the resistance of the plant is at a relatively weak stage. It needs to be well maintained and managed, and the growth environment should be kept ventilated and breathable, as well as with reasonable light, to avoid a hot and humid environment to prevent the breeding of pests. After the plant has adapted to the pot, apply fertilizer in moderation to promote stronger growth of the plant.
